Description
"When Thea Ahern lands a job at LetSlip, a gossip magazine, she takes it even though it will mean hiding her heritage. When she helps a man on the subway, she's hailed as the angel on L train, and people notice her striking resemblance to a once famous actress. This sparks a renewed interest in Paris Hulette. What happened to the actress after her husband shot her? And is Thea Ahern really the actress's daughter? Thea's coworker, John, shields Thea from the ensuing media frenzy. But LetSlip's CEO is murdered, John's past is revealed. Can Thea ever trust him again? And can he ever be forgiven for what he's done?"-- back cover.
